The Good Book

Drawing on the wisdom of 2,500 years of contemplative non-religious writing on all that it means to be human – from the origins of the universe to small matters of courtesy and kindness in everyday life – A. C. Grayling has created a secular bible.

The Challenge of Things

The Challenge of Things collects Grayling’s most recent essays on the world in a time of war and conflict. By thinking through difficult topics in troubled times, Grayling examines the habits and prejudices of the mind that might otherwise trap us in a sterile cul-de-sac and opens up the possibility of more creative approaches.
